What to Do If You Lose Your Car Key Can It Be Tracked?
1 Answers
Lost car keys cannot be tracked. If the key is misplaced at home or in a safe place and not stolen or lost, you may consider getting a duplicate key. However, if possible, it is safer to replace the entire car lock system entirely. There are two places where you can get a replacement key if you lose your car key. One is at a 4S store, and the other is at an auto parts market. Below are detailed introductions to the two methods: 1. The first method is to go to a 4S store for a replacement: Staff at the 4S store will typically locate the corresponding key code for your car model, then deactivate the lost key code, and finally issue a new key code. This way, even if the lost key is found, it won't pose a security risk. 2. The second method is to go to an auto parts market for a replacement: However, getting a key duplicated at an auto parts market carries some security risks. The auto parts market only replicates the key's code without deactivating the lost one. On the upside, getting a key duplicated at an auto parts market is several times cheaper than at a 4S store. Each method has its own advantages and disadvantages.
